Ever looked at a total station and wondered how it works?

Total Station for Beginners provides a practical introduction to total station equipment, basic surveying concepts, and common field procedures. Written in clear, accessible language, this guide is designed for beginners, new field workers, tradespeople, landowners who want to understand the basics, and anyone interested in learning about total station surveying.

Inside, you'll learn how to:

  • Set up, level, and configure a total station
  • Measure angles and distances
  • Organize and record field data
  • Understand reflectorless and robotic total stations
  • Identify common measurement and setup errors
  • Understand common instrument messages and basic troubleshooting
  • Work with field measurements and prepare data for site plans
  • Apply fundamental total station techniques in typical field situations
The chapters progress from basic concepts to practical field procedures, supported by clear explanations and illustrations.

Whether you are new to surveying equipment or want to build a stronger understanding of total stations, this book provides a straightforward introduction to the subject.
